 |  |  |  | The City Of Violence (see film details) Action/Adventure / Crime
 "City Of Violence" had everything you could wish for and more. If you want to get a bit picky, you could say it imatates "Kill Bill" in some ways. But Tarantino himself stole the ideas for "Kill Bill" from this sort of film like the old Shaw Brothers. The fight scenes are hyper but brutul and realistic--unlike the Crazy 88 fight in "Kill Bill", which is good but way over the top. If you have seen the director's other films you will enjoy this. It seems that this is the kind of film he set out to make previously. The best thing about this moive is that it throws everthing into the mix: freindship, corruption, murder, plot twists, but most of all some of the best old school kung fu I have seen since "Prodigal Son" and "The Eight Diagram Pole Fighter".
